Cookies

Certain information is automatically collected by the Company’s internet servers, such as your Internet Service Provider and IP address, the pages you view within the Website and the amount of time you spend in certain areas of the Website.
When you view the Company’s Website, the Company may temporarily store “cookies” or other web beacons on your computer.  A “cookie” is a small data file that is sent from a website’s server and is stored on another device’s hard drive.  You can adjust your browser settings to accept or reject most cookies altogether or to monitor the storage of cookies on your device. You should refer to your browser settings to determine what options are available to you. Some cookies may be required in order to allow you to access and use our Website. By completely disabling cookies, you may not be able to access some or all of the features of our Website.

We mainly use cookies to obtain and store information about Website traffic (such as the extent of repeat usage) and Website visitors’ viewing patterns and preferences based on which pages a visitor accesses or views.  We use this information to compile statistics, to create targeted marketing and to customize Website content. These cookies allow us to personalize your experience on our Website. Some cookies will also store information for your convenience (such as a zip code to help locate Company offerings closest to you or login information) and will allow you to customize your experience on our Website.

We may also use transparent images that are embedded in web pages, applications, and emails called “web beacons” to test the effectiveness of our marketing, and to track whether an email has been opened.
